Land Acknowledgement
Solas Energy is located in Calgary Alberta and acknowledges that we live, work and play on the traditional territories of the Blackfoot Confederacy, which includes Siksika, the Piikani, and the Kainai. We also acknowledge the Tsuut’ina and Stoney Nakoda First Nations, the Métis Nation (Region 3), and all people who make their homes in the Treaty 7 region of Southern Alberta.

About Solas Energy
Solas Energy provides comprehensive strategy and consulting services to support the energy transition. With multiple decades of experience in project development, construction management, and climate change advisory, Solas Energy provides its clients with the depth and perspective required to navigate the complex issues associated with renewable energy project development and climate change policy.
